FLUORESCENCE POLARIZATION-BASED METHOD FOR ANALYSIS OF FARNESOID X RECEPTOR-LIGAND COMPLEX INTERACTION AND FOR SCREENING INHIBITORS AGAINST THE FARNESOID X RECEPTOR-LIGAND COMPLEX BINDING

The present invention relates to a method for analyzing the interaction of a panesoid X receptor-ligand complex using fluorescence polarization and a method for screening binding inhibitors, and specifically, between a panesoid X receptor (FXR) and a fluorescently labeled ligand using fluorescence polarization. Interaction analysis method and binding inhibitory candidates were added to samples containing fluorescently labeled ligands and Panesoid X receptors, and fluorescent fluorescence was measured to confirm competitive binding of ligands to inhibitors of binding to Panesoid X receptors. The present invention relates to a method for screening a binding inhibitor of a panesoid X receptor and a ligand complex. The interaction analysis method and binding inhibitor search method of the present invention can be effectively applied to the ultra-fast search using the well plate is very useful for the development of hyperlipidemia therapeutics.;Panesoid X Receptor, Fluorescence Polarization, Ligand
